        # What is kross ?
        
        kross is a tool to automate the build of Docker images for multiple architectures without any changes required on your code
        
        # Quick start
        
        * Install via pip
        
        `pip install kross`
        
        * Initialize it (once)
        
        `kross init`
        
        * Update your docker build commands
        
        > Before
        
        ```
        docker build -t me/myapp:vX.X.X ...args... path/to/docker/context
        docker push me/myapp:vX.X.X
        ```
        
        > After
        
        ```
        kross build -t me/myapp:vX.X.X ...args... path/to/docker/context
        kross push me/myapp:vX.X.X
        ```
        
        # Why kross ?
        
        Kross is born from a Raspberry Pi passionnate developer.
        Because Raspberry Pi are arm-based and 90% of images on Dockerhub are amd64-based, developers have to duplicate/tweak all Dockerfiles so the image will work on it and avoid the too much popular `cannot execute binary file: Exec format error`.

        # How kross is working ?
        
        kross is based upon the [qemu library](https://www.qemu.org/) to build multiple architectures images on a amd64-based host machine.
        After all images are built and pushed to a docker registry, a [manifest list](https://docs.docker.com/engine/reference/commandline/manifest/#create-and-push-a-manifest-list) is pushed too so that users can pull images based on their architectures in a seamless way.

        # Supported architectures
        
        kross will try to build images for the following architectures:
        
        * amd64
        * arm32v6
        * arm32v7
        * arm64v8
        * ppc64le
        * s390x
        * i386
